Compare Oildale to Chula Vista

This post compares Oildale, California to Chula Vista, California across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Oildale (CDP) Chula Vista (city)
Population 34,496 264,101
Income (median) $40,558 $49,825
Home Value (median) $136,100 $433,500
White 85% 66%
Black 2% 4%
Asian 0% 15%
With Kids 37% 44%
Age (median) 32 34
Rentals 63% 42%
